PM Boris Johnson has divided voters with his controversial tea-making methods.
The Conservatives shared a video showing the Prime Minister answering some questions about his day-to-day life and the forthcoming general election – all while taking a quick tea break.
Read more: EastEnders’ Barbara Windsor calls for Boris Johnson to solve dementia care crisis
In the video, posted across the party’s social media platforms on Tuesday (12.11.19), Boris is seen walking through his campaign offices while someone behind the camera fires questions at him.
Halfway through, he reaches a small kitchen and fetches a mug before adding a teabag, then boiling water and then a splash of milk.
More controversially, the PM appears to walk away from the kitchen with the teabag still floating in the mug.
On Facebook, many people in the comments struggled to get past the tea issue.
One asked: “Anyone else annoyed by the fact that he put the milk in whilst the tea bag was still in the mug?”
Someone else wrote: “He left the tea bag in and didn’t allow it to brew and was spilling the tea!”
A third said: “Is it wrong that I couldn’t concentrate on the last part because I was so concerned that he hadn’t taken his teabag out, but had put the milk in and was prepared to walk away with the tea… teabag still in it!”

“God… Boris needs a lesson as to how to make a cup of tea!” insisted a fourth.
Another said: “I could never vote for someone who makes a cup of tea and pours the milk in with the bag. Bad form old chap.”
But not everyone was unimpressed, as one Facebook user commented: “How can you wave your cup of tea around like that and not spill it?! Secret skills!”
“Haha legend,” commented another, adding: “This is the Boris I love.”
